Virginia Huynh advocates for Sean Combs' bail release
Virginia Huynh, identified as 'Victim 3' in Sean Combs' recent trial, has submitted a letter urging the judge to release the music mogul on bail. This request comes as Combs awaits sentencing for two counts related to sexual charges, after being acquitted of more serious allegations. Huynh's letter, attached to Combs' legal team's filing, emphasizes her perception of his character, noting that he has not shown violence for years. She argues that granting him bail would allow him to better support his children and aid the healing process for all parties involved. Combs' attorneys claim there are "exceptional reasons" for bail, while prosecutors highlight his history of violence as a potential risk.

The request brought forth by Huynh highlights a complex angle in the case against Sean Combs. While he has been convicted of serious charges, the legal and ethical implications of releasing someone with a history of violence remain contentious. Huynh's appeal underscores the ongoing tension between victims’ rights and rehabilitative arguments, where public perception of Combs' character may influence judicial outcomes. The impending sentencing will be critical in shaping both Combs' future and public sentiment regarding accountability and justice in high-profile cases.
